We are seeking a dynamic and detail-oriented Live Events Technical Manager to be the critical coordination point for live productions at our Stamford, CT Studios. In this pivotal role, you will be the technical linchpin ensuring seamless execution of remotely produced live sports, bridging the technical communications between production, engineering, and all operations teams.
Responsibilities:
Live Event Production Support
• Serve as the primary Stamford technical point of contact during live productions
• Conduct real-time quality control of video and audio signals
• Provide immediate, executive-level communication of technical issues
• Assist with technical setup and troubleshooting
• Partner with the Onsite Venue Tech Manager on all technical show executions
Technical Planning and Coordination
• Develop comprehensive technical plans and documentation for live events
• Manage pre- and post-show technical meetings
• Create detailed show reports; issues, improvements and production insights
• Resolve potential technical resource conflicts proactively
Strategic Technology Engagement
• Collaborate with Production, Tech Ops, and Engineering teams
• Assess and recommend improvements to technical operations workflows
• Participate in testing and implementation of new workflows
Cross-Team Collaboration
• Foster strong relationships across internal teams and external partners
• Facilitate clear, effective communication between departments
• Escalate technical issues appropriately and ensure timely resolution
